Social Impact of drinking

Drinking - I mean consumption of Alcohol. This is the biggest social issues today in India. Most of the crimes and accidents today happen due to the consumption of Alcohol.

Why are we not able to handle this issue effectively? There are various reasons. Here are my thoughts on the social impact this habit is bringing to our society.

The first and foremost is the abuse of females at home. There are millions of cases in rural and in some case urban society where a drunk husband beats up his wife. In most cases, they beat up their wife to steal money for consuming alcohol.

Currently there is an active campaign happening in Tamil Nadu for ban on liquor and especially on the government licensed Liquor shops. This comes from the outbreak of many poor family housewives who complain that most of their incomes goes in drinking.  Some people cause nuisance in public after drinking as most of these shops are on the main streets.

So why is government not able to apply a ban on these shops? There is a study which tells that most of these shops are owned by ruling and opposition party politicians who fear loss on income. The government roughly earns 20,000 crores of money every year due to these shops which is quite a revenue which they don’t want to do away with. Then what is the solution. There has to be alternative ways of income which the government needs to plan. Selling poisonous drink is not an acceptable way of income for the government.

The government can’t be blamed completely as well. The society on its own has to revolt strongly as well. Breaking few shops or doing a one off protest during elections will not help the cause. There has been a long and strong protest which needs to bring in the attention of national and international media.
